What personal coaching do I offer you?

I use the Co-Active model of coaching. This involves:

  • Getting you out of your comfort zone so you can learn new skills and fresh perspectives

  • Applying life lessons through simple frameworks that can be easily applied to many life situations

  • Focusing on powerful experiences that can inform and even direct your present and future

  • Giving you a supportive, confidential, and safe space where you can be vulnerable and learn to face your fears and doubts

  • Use of both in-person and digital sources to provide transformative learning

  • Demonstrating what is possible when you harness all of your inner strength and power

Yeah, but what does that mean?

In practical terms, I use a variety of improvisational techniques to guide you to step out of your comfort zone, tap into your powerful and often suppressed positive and negative emotions, and gain shifts in your perspectives. These mainly include; asking powerful and open-ended questions which make you think deeply, role play to embody an emotion and/or situation, visualizations to identify your values and inner strength, accountability assignments and goal setting, acknowledgments and championing, etc. My approach is to keep things light and playful whenever possible – even though it’s work and can be emotional at times, it can be fun too! I give you the space you need to wonder, uncover and discover new ideas, and discard old ones which no longer serve you and your desires.
